skunk2 throttle body
on the part of the throttle body where the throttle cable goes on (the rotor thingy), theres an adjustment nut under it. with the car off, open the throttle and u should see an adjustment nut. it will be pretty tough to get to the nut to adjust it withthe TB bolted onto the IM. i think its a 5/16" nut. u will need to loosen the nut and then lower the setting with an allen key (very small size allen key). i just removed the enitre nut and allen key screw from the throttle body and the idle went to 750. remove that nut and see if it helps.
the idle ajustment screw on the top of the TB doest work for me. i tried turn n it with a flat head in both directions but it did nothing to lower the idle rpm. so i had to remove that adjustemtn nut mentioned above
